Lloyds Banking Group Plc - Form 6-K Summary
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 6-K, dated October 3, 2022, reports a specific transaction in own shares by Lloyds Banking Group Plc. The filing serves as a regulatory announcement regarding the execution of a share buyback programme.
Key Financial Metrics
The filing details a single-day share repurchase transaction rather than comprehensive financial statements. Key metrics for this transaction include:
- Shares Purchased: 106,529,371 ordinary shares.
- Transaction Date: October 3, 2022.
- Price Range: Between 40.46 pence (lowest) and 42.25 pence (highest) per share.
- Volume Weighted Average Price (VWAP): 41.53 pence per share.
- Broker: Morgan Stanley & Co. International plc.

Material Changes
This transaction represents a reduction in the company's outstanding share count as part of an existing buyback programme. The shares purchased are intended to be cancelled. No other material changes to financial position or operations are disclosed in this specific filing.
Guidance, Outlook, and Risks
The transaction was executed pursuant to instructions issued to the broker on February 24, 2022, as announced on February 25, 2022. The filing references compliance with Article 5(1)(b) of Regulation (EU) No 596/2014 (Market Abuse Regulation).
